中文摘要

利用體外超音波源對癌症患者的體內病灶照射,可加強放射線療法或化學療法對癌症之療效,且此種熱療法亦得成為獨立之癌症療法。前述之療法無須進行外科手術開刀,且無須對患者全身麻醉,因而減少許多相應之治療風險與副作用。本文簡介此癌症超音波熱療法之主要儀器組成、加熱原理、熱劑量計算方法、能量聚焦原理、治療計畫之電腦輔助原理與此等療法於人體之生化原理,以利讀者了解此種需要跨領域專業之儀器的相關基本理論。

英文摘要

Irradiating the diseased site of a patient having cancer using external ultrasonic sources could enhance the effi cacy
of radiotherapy or chemotherapy, and these kinds of treatments by themselves could be an option of therapies
treating cancer. The aforementioned therapies require no surgical operation and general anesthetization, and
thus they have lower risk and fewer complications associated with them. The article briefl y introduced the major
components of the devices for these kinds of therapies, the principles of heating, the methods for calculation of
the thermal dose, the principles of energy focusing, the principles of computer-aided treatment planning, and the
biochemical principles for applying these therapies to human; this introduction would help the readers understand
the related multi-disciplinary principles associated with these kinds of therapies.
